A woman who left the Amish community long ago returns to Pennsylvaniaâ??and finds herself negotiating between her people and the police...

In this unique mystery debut, a shallow grave is found on a Pennsylvania farm, and one woman straddling the Amish and outside worlds must uncover a killerâ??and create a life on her own terms...
Fifteen years after leaving her Old Order Amish life, Rachel Mast has returned to Stone Mill, Pennsylvania. Corporate success didn't bring true happiness, but Rachel also knows she can never be Amish again. Instead she runs a B&B and tries to help her community in ways they can't help themselves.
But now a gruesome discovery has been made on her Uncle Aaron's cow pastureâ??the body of prominent Englisher businessman Willy O'Day. Aaron refuses to hire a lawyer, trusting his innocence, and his faith, to see him through. Rachel isn't so sure, especially given the long public feud between the two men. Her relatives won't speak to the police, but they will talk to Rachelâ??if she puts on a skirt and bonnet. Rachel knows emotions and entanglements run as complicated in the Amish world as outside it. But as she delves deeper to clear Aaron's name, she discovers secrets that put her own life in danger...

Fifteen years ago, Rachel Mast left her Amish home for a different lifestyle. She has returned to the town where she grew up, but not as a member of the Amish community. Not having been baptized, she is not shunned, but not exactly welcomed with open arms, either. When her uncle is arrested, Rachel must prove his innocence to the police, without her uncle’s help. Being Amish, he places his trust solely in God and will do or say nothing in his own defense. Author Emma Miller does an excellent job of portraying a woman formally Amish but still feeling her roots, who is living in the English world but wishing for some of the Amish ways. Her conflicted feelings come across loud and clear, as she really does not feel at home in either world. A well-crafted mystery with well-developed characters. ( )

I enjoyed this murder mystery that brought together the Amish and what they call "English," as Rachel who left the religion before baptism has returned to the town her family lives in. A man is killed and her uncle is suspect because the body is found in his field. She alternates her time between running her B & B and trying to find out who really killed the guy. I knew who did it because I had read the author's next book, but it didn't take away the enjoyment of getting to know the characters better. I hope she writes more books in this series. ( )
